To Buy Another Home

If you intend to buy another home once you have sold your property, there is an advantage to short sales over foreclosures. Fannie Mae regulations state that homeowners who complete a short sale of their home are eligible within two years to buy another home. With foreclosure, you might have to wait much longer, up to five years. If you are not more than 60 days behind on your mortgage payments, there is a possibility that you could be immediately eligible to buy another home once the short sale is complete.

Stop Making Mortgage Payments

If you are having financial hardships and are unable to continue to make your mortgage payments, you may want to consider a short sale of your home. During the short sale process, you will not be required to make any additional mortgage payments. Often, you are allowed to stay in the home until the short sale process is complete. This will give you the time you need to find another place to live.
